Reebok Brings Back The 3D Opus Runner

Reebok Brings Back The 3D Opus Runner

After reintroducing their classic DMX Daytona running shoe recently, Reebok is dipping into their extensive archives once again, this time to re-introduce the 3D Opus. A unique basketball-inspired running silhouette originally released in 1998, the Opus has been given a modern day update via a 3D Ultralight sole which offers a lighter feel and more comfortable ride without sacrificing any of the shoe’s retro styling. Arriving in both a gold/black/grey and a green/black/grey, the shoes feature a light-weight textile upper with suede overlays on the gold pair and patent leather overlays on the green pair. Both feature an abstract-style lacing system and a unique cut-out collar design to save a little extra weight. Retro Reebok branding arrives on the tongue and heel, and the shoe is completed with a carbon fiber plate that serves as a midsole. Want to take it back to the future with your footwear? Both pairs of the 3D Opus are available now at END.
